PRECALCULUS : find an interval of length 1 in which f(x) = x^3 – 4x^2 + 2x – 7 is guaranteed to have a zero.

OpenStudy (anonymous):

function is continous so we need to find an interval like [a,b] for which f(a)>0 and f(b)<0 or f(a)<0 and f(b)>0

OpenStudy (rsadhvika):

intermediate value theorem should i setup a table ?

OpenStudy (rsadhvika):

x, f(x) ?

OpenStudy (anonymous):

Start putting some integer values in, say: 1, 2, 3 etc. When you get results which change sign, you know that there will be a zero between then. Yes do a table if you like.

OpenStudy (rsadhvika):

oh its lot easier than i thought it was.... thnks !

OpenStudy (rsadhvika):

i got the interval (3, 4) thnks a lot xD
